Unlocking the Advantages of MSME Certificate

Wiki Article

Gaining an MSME certificate may unlock a host of benefits for your enterprise. To be eligible, your venture must meet certain standards outlined by the governing body.

Typically, this comprises factors such as yearly income limits, the number of staff you employ, and the kind of your field. Once you acquire your MSME certificate, you will become qualified for a range of incentives designed to assist medium-sized businesses.

These can vary depending on your region, but often involve things like tax breaks, easier access to credit, and advantageous treatment in government procurement.

Ultimately, obtaining an MSME certificate can be a valuable asset for any entrepreneur looking to thrive in the competitive business.

Secure an MSME Certificate Requirements

Securing an MSME certificate can unlock numerous benefits for your business. To successfully navigate this process, it's crucial to understand the essential criteria involved.

First and foremost, you must confirm that your business meets the classification of a Micro, Small, or Medium Enterprise as outlined by the governing body. This typically involves assessing factors such as yearly revenue, property value, and number of staff.

Once you've confirmed your company's suitability, you'll need to file a comprehensive form to the designated agency. This application usually requires comprehensive information about your venture, including incorporation details, financial reports, and other relevant evidence.

It's essential to conform with all the procedures provided by the designated authority.

Meticulous record-keeping and accurate details are paramount throughout the process.
